创建数据库对象时需要什么
-
在创建数据库对象时,通常需要考虑以下几个方面:
-
数据库设计:在创建数据库对象之前,首先需要进行数据库设计。数据库设计是指对数据库的整体结构和组织方式进行规划和设计,包括确定数据库中的数据表、字段、索引等对象的结构和关系。在数据库设计阶段,需要考虑到数据的完整性、一致性和安全性等方面,确保数据库对象的设计符合业务需求和性能要求。
-
数据库对象的类型:在创建数据库对象时,需要确定要创建的数据库对象的类型。常见的数据库对象包括数据表、视图、索引、存储过程、触发器等。不同类型的数据库对象具有不同的功能和用途,根据实际需求选择合适的数据库对象类型进行创建。
-
数据表的设计:数据表是数据库中最基本的对象,用于存储数据。在创建数据表时,需要确定数据表的名称、字段名、数据类型、约束条件等信息。数据表的设计应该符合数据的结构和关系,避免冗余数据和数据不一致等问题。
-
索引的创建:索引是用于加快数据库查询速度的数据结构,可以提高数据库的性能。在创建数据库对象时,通常需要创建适当的索引来优化数据库查询操作。索引的选择和创建需要根据查询的频率和条件进行优化,避免创建过多或不必要的索引。
-
数据库对象的权限管理:在创建数据库对象时,需要考虑数据库对象的权限管理。权限管理是指对数据库对象的访问权限进行控制,确保只有经过授权的用户可以访问和操作数据库对象。通过合理的权限管理可以保护数据库的安全性,防止未经授权的用户对数据库对象进行操作。
1年前 -
-
创建数据库对象是在数据库中存储和组织数据的重要步骤。在创建数据库对象之前,您需要考虑以下几个方面:
-
数据库设计:在创建数据库对象之前,您需要进行数据库设计。数据库设计是指确定数据库的结构、关系和约束的过程。这包括确定数据表的字段、数据类型、主键、外键以及表与表之间的关系等。
-
数据表:数据表是数据库中存储数据的基本单位。在创建数据库对象时,您需要首先创建数据表。数据表通常由列和行组成,列定义了表中存储的数据的属性,行则表示实际存储的数据记录。
-
列定义:在创建数据表时,您需要定义每一列的名称、数据类型、约束条件等。数据类型定义了列可以存储的数据类型,如整数、字符型、日期型等。约束条件可以限制列中存储的数据的取值范围,如唯一约束、主键约束、外键约束等。
-
约束条件:约束条件用于确保数据的完整性和一致性。常见的约束条件包括主键约束(Primary Key)、外键约束(Foreign Key)、唯一约束(Unique Key)、非空约束(Not Null)等。
-
索引:索引是数据库中用于加快数据检索速度的重要对象。在创建数据库对象时,您可以为经常用于检索的列创建索引,以提高查询效率。
-
视图:视图是基于一个或多个表的查询结果集。在创建数据库对象时,您可以创建视图来简化复杂查询、保护数据安全性和隐藏数据结构等。
-
存储过程和触发器:存储过程和触发器是数据库中用于实现业务逻辑和数据操作的重要对象。在创建数据库对象时,您可以创建存储过程和触发器来执行复杂的数据操作和业务逻辑。
总之,创建数据库对象时需要考虑数据库设计、数据表、列定义、约束条件、索引、视图、存储过程和触发器等多个方面,以确保数据库的结构合理、数据完整性和一致性得到保障,并且提高数据库的性能和可维护性。
1年前 -
-
创建数据库对象时,您需要考虑以下几个方面:
-
数据库设计:
- 首先,您需要确定数据库的设计,包括表的结构、关系、字段和约束等。这可以通过实体关系图(ER图)或其他数据库设计工具来完成。
- 在设计数据库时,需要考虑数据的组织结构、数据类型、索引、主键、外键等内容。
-
数据库管理系统(DBMS)的选择:
- 根据您的需求和预算,选择合适的数据库管理系统,如MySQL、SQL Server、Oracle、PostgreSQL等。
- 根据选择的数据库管理系统,您需要了解其特定的创建数据库对象的语法和规范。
-
数据库对象的创建:
- 创建数据库对象需要使用数据库管理系统提供的特定的SQL语句或通过图形化界面工具来完成。
- 数据库对象可以包括数据库、表、视图、存储过程、函数、触发器等。
-
数据库安全性:
- 在创建数据库对象时,需要考虑数据库的安全性,包括用户权限、访问控制、加密等方面的设置。
-
数据库备份与恢复:
- 在创建数据库对象之后,您需要考虑数据库的备份和恢复策略,确保数据的安全性和可靠性。
下面是创建数据库对象的一般操作流程:
-
连接数据库管理系统:
- 使用合适的数据库管理工具,如MySQL Workbench、SQL Server Management Studio等,连接到数据库管理系统。
-
创建数据库:
- 使用SQL语句或图形化界面工具,在数据库管理系统中创建新的数据库。
- 在创建数据库时,您需要指定数据库的名称、字符集、校对规则等属性。
-
创建表:
- 在新创建的数据库中,使用SQL语句或图形化界面工具创建表格。
- 在创建表格时,需要指定表格的名称、字段、数据类型、约束条件等信息。
-
创建其他数据库对象:
- 根据需求,可以创建视图、存储过程、函数、触发器等其他数据库对象。
-
设置数据库安全性:
- 针对新创建的数据库对象,设置合适的用户权限、访问控制等安全设置。
-
备份与恢复:
- 设定数据库的定期备份策略,确保数据的安全性。
- 在需要时,可以使用备份文件进行数据库的恢复操作。
通过以上操作流程,您可以创建符合需求的数据库对象,并确保数据库的安全性和可靠性。
1年前 -


